Since you said Montreal, I think you must be speaking of St Louis built stainless ex-Arrow-I's, identical to what is running on the San Joaquins. Back East, we nickname them Com-Arrows. When they were converted from MU to loco hauled cars in the late 1980's, the center doors were plugged.

I can report with certainty that four comet cars were deposited on the wye at OERM when I arrived this morning. They arrived complete with graffiti and some "dismantled windows" but otherwise serviceable. As I left today the cars were having their graffiti removed as quickly as possible so they can be used next weekend for our first combined Thomas and Percy the Tank Engines. We will be using three different diesels during the five day event starting next Saturday
